package org.openqa.selenium.devtools.v90.overlay.model;

import org.openqa.selenium.Beta;
import org.openqa.selenium.json.JsonInput;

/**
 * Configuration data for the highlighting of page elements.
 */
public class HighlightConfig {

    private final java.util.Optional showInfo;

    private final java.util.Optional showStyles;

    private final java.util.Optional showRulers;

    private final java.util.Optional showAccessibilityInfo;

    private final java.util.Optional showExtensionLines;

    private final java.util.Optional contentColor;

    private final java.util.Optional paddingColor;

    private final java.util.Optional borderColor;

    private final java.util.Optional marginColor;

    private final java.util.Optional eventTargetColor;

    private final java.util.Optional shapeColor;

    private final java.util.Optional shapeMarginColor;

    private final java.util.Optional cssGridColor;

    private final java.util.Optional colorFormat;

    private final java.util.Optional gridHighlightConfig;

    private final java.util.Optional flexContainerHighlightConfig;

    private final java.util.Optional flexItemHighlightConfig;

    private final java.util.Optional contrastAlgorithm;

    public HighlightConfig(java.util.Optional showInfo, java.util.Optional showStyles, java.util.Optional showRulers, java.util.Optional showAccessibilityInfo, java.util.Optional showExtensionLines, java.util.Optional contentColor, java.util.Optional paddingColor, java.util.Optional borderColor, java.util.Optional marginColor, java.util.Optional eventTargetColor, java.util.Optional shapeColor, java.util.Optional shapeMarginColor, java.util.Optional cssGridColor, java.util.Optional colorFormat, java.util.Optional gridHighlightConfig, java.util.Optional flexContainerHighlightConfig, java.util.Optional flexItemHighlightConfig, java.util.Optional contrastAlgorithm) {
        this.showInfo = showInfo;
        this.showStyles = showStyles;
        this.showRulers = showRulers;
        this.showAccessibilityInfo = showAccessibilityInfo;
        this.showExtensionLines = showExtensionLines;
        this.contentColor = contentColor;
        this.paddingColor = paddingColor;
        this.borderColor = borderColor;
        this.marginColor = marginColor;
        this.eventTargetColor = eventTargetColor;
        this.shapeColor = shapeColor;
        this.shapeMarginColor = shapeMarginColor;
        this.cssGridColor = cssGridColor;
        this.colorFormat = colorFormat;
        this.gridHighlightConfig = gridHighlightConfig;
        this.flexContainerHighlightConfig = flexContainerHighlightConfig;
        this.flexItemHighlightConfig = flexItemHighlightConfig;
        this.contrastAlgorithm = contrastAlgorithm;
    }

    /**
     * Whether the node info tooltip should be shown (default: false).
     */
    public java.util.Optional getShowInfo() {
        return showInfo;
    }

    /**
     * Whether the node styles in the tooltip (default: false).
     */
    public java.util.Optional getShowStyles() {
        return showStyles;
    }

    /**
     * Whether the rulers should be shown (default: false).
     */
    public java.util.Optional getShowRulers() {
        return showRulers;
    }

    /**
     * Whether the a11y info should be shown (default: true).
     */
    public java.util.Optional getShowAccessibilityInfo() {
        return showAccessibilityInfo;
    }

    /**
     * Whether the extension lines from node to the rulers should be shown (default: false).
     */
    public java.util.Optional getShowExtensionLines() {
        return showExtensionLines;
    }

    /**
     * The content box highlight fill color (default: transparent).
     */
    public java.util.Optional getContentColor() {
        return contentColor;
    }

    /**
     * The padding highlight fill color (default: transparent).
     */
    public java.util.Optional getPaddingColor() {
        return paddingColor;
    }

    /**
     * The border highlight fill color (default: transparent).
     */
    public java.util.Optional getBorderColor() {
        return borderColor;
    }

    /**
     * The margin highlight fill color (default: transparent).
     */
    public java.util.Optional getMarginColor() {
        return marginColor;
    }

    /**
     * The event target element highlight fill color (default: transparent).
     */
    public java.util.Optional getEventTargetColor() {
        return eventTargetColor;
    }

    /**
     * The shape outside fill color (default: transparent).
     */
    public java.util.Optional getShapeColor() {
        return shapeColor;
    }

    /**
     * The shape margin fill color (default: transparent).
     */
    public java.util.Optional getShapeMarginColor() {
        return shapeMarginColor;
    }

    /**
     * The grid layout color (default: transparent).
     */
    public java.util.Optional getCssGridColor() {
        return cssGridColor;
    }

    /**
     * The color format used to format color styles (default: hex).
     */
    public java.util.Optional getColorFormat() {
        return colorFormat;
    }

    /**
     * The grid layout highlight configuration (default: all transparent).
     */
    public java.util.Optional getGridHighlightConfig() {
        return gridHighlightConfig;
    }

    /**
     * The flex container highlight configuration (default: all transparent).
     */
    public java.util.Optional getFlexContainerHighlightConfig() {
        return flexContainerHighlightConfig;
    }

    /**
     * The flex item highlight configuration (default: all transparent).
     */
    public java.util.Optional getFlexItemHighlightConfig() {
        return flexItemHighlightConfig;
    }

    /**
     * The contrast algorithm to use for the contrast ratio (default: aa).
     */
    public java.util.Optional getContrastAlgorithm() {
        return contrastAlgorithm;
    }
